    The Foreign, Comparative and International Law Special Interest Section of the
    American Association of Law Libraries (FCIL) is now accepting applications for
    the 2009 FCIL Schaffer Grant.

    The FCIL Schaffer Grant for the July 25-28, 2009 Annual Meeting in Washington,
    DC provides a waiver of the AALL Annual Meeting full registration fee and a
    grant of a minimum $2,000 to assist with accommodations and travel costs.

    Applicants must be law librarians, or other professionals working in the legal
    information field, currently employed in countries other than the United States
    with significant responsibility for the organization, preservation, or
    provision of legal information. The application deadline is March 1, 2009.
    The Grant Committee will not consider late or incomplete applications.
